Frequently asked

How is this different from Google's Daily Brief or the new Siri?

They'll tell you what's on your calendar and can add events for you. Neither one texts you in the evening to ask whether you did the thing you said mattered — and neither does it without making you feel managed. MakeMyDay closes the loop: you commit, it checks in, and a miss is just information. That's the part your phone doesn't do.

Isn't this just reminders?

Reminders fire and forget. MakeMyDay follows up — it asks how it went with a simple DONE, SKIP, or SNOOZE, and a miss is just information, never a guilt trip. All by text, no app.

Do I have to connect my calendar?

It's better with it — connecting Google Calendar lets MakeMyDay see when you're actually free. But the follow-through loop works on its own if you'd rather not.

Is my calendar data secure? Who can see it?

Your calendar stays in your Google account. MakeMyDay connects through Google's official, secure authorization — it reads and writes events when you ask it to, but doesn't store your full calendar history on our servers. We never sell or share your data.

Will I get spam texts from MakeMyDay?

No. MakeMyDay only texts you when you text it first, or when you've explicitly opted into reminders, morning briefings, or check-ins. Reply STOP to any message to disable everything. Message frequency is whatever you make it.

What does the AI actually have access to?

MakeMyDay reads your incoming texts to figure out what you're asking for ("add gym at 5pm" → create an event), and it has read access to your Google Calendar so it can answer questions about your schedule. It does not touch your email, contacts, or other Google services. The AI that interprets your texts never sees more than that.

How do I cancel?

Reply STOP to any MakeMyDay text and you're unsubscribed immediately. Pro subscribers can cancel from the account page — billing stops at the end of the current period and you keep access until then. We don't make you call us or jump through hoops.

Does this work with non-Google calendars?

Not yet. MakeMyDay currently supports Google Calendar only. Outlook, iCloud, and Apple Calendar support are on the roadmap. If one of those is a dealbreaker for you, sign up for the waitlist and tell us which one — we prioritize by demand.
